Important information has emerged regarding Google's next major software update, Android 17. Reports suggest that this time the company may release the update ahead of schedule. Android 17 is reportedly codenamed Cinnamon Bun, and its development is progressing rapidly. Its beta version will likely arrive in February or March 2026, with a stable version rolling out by June 2026. Minor design changes, improved privacy, and new features for larger screens could be highlights of this update.
Preparing for an Early Rollout
Reports suggest that Google may push back the Android 17 beta timeline this time. While betas typically arrive mid-year, Android 17 Beta 1 could launch in late February or early March 2026. If this schedule remains, the public beta version could be released soon, and the stable version could arrive by June 2026. As usual, Pixel devices will receive this update first, followed by other brands.
Minor design changes, feature improvements
According to leaks, Android 17 won't feature a major design overhaul, but the interface will be made smoother and more responsive. The notification shade could be faster, and icons could change based on the wallpaper. Furthermore, improved multi-window support, a taskbar-style interface, and improved keyboard and mouse compatibility could be added. Lock screen widgets are also expected to return, allowing you to view important information without unlocking the phone.
Special focus on privacy and control
Android 17 could introduce stricter privacy measures. More control over background apps and improved intrusion logging tools could be included, allowing users to see which apps are accessing data, when, and how. New keyboard customization options could also be added, improving accessibility and the user experience. Overall, this update could focus on strengthening stability and security.
Which phones will get Android 17?
Although Google hasn't released an official list, based on current policies, the Pixel 6 series and newer models may be eligible to receive Android 17. The upcoming Pixel 11 series may launch with this new version. Samsung's Galaxy S23, S24, S25, and upcoming S26 series, along with Galaxy Z Fold models, are also expected to receive the One UI 9 update. Additionally, the OnePlus 11, 12, 13, and Open, Xiaomi 14 and 15 series, some Redmi Note premium models, and Motorola Edge and Razr foldable devices may also be included in this list. The final decision will depend on the brand's own update policy.
